The issue is the self reliance on:
- basic safety.
- heating.
- water.
- food.
- power.

My point here is that a lot of complex systems (such as power generators) have a very limited life time, hence you either need the uber reliable systems (such as a long term solid nuclear power plant design with no moving parts in it and 0 maintenance life time of hundreds of years) or some sort of industrial capacity to keep your technology going (and replace it as it wears out).

However if it is a limited time period we are talking about (up to several years) then nothing could beat an old fashioned fall out shelter sufficiently stocked with expendables and with reliable equipment (water, air filters, power generator).
